Transaction e32ad8f0417d73a79c839eb281ffdd9d064f0bdeb8640710e4fd3695e13a091e
1 Input
1 Output
-
e32ad8f0417d73a79c839eb281ffdd9d064f0bdeb8640710e4fd3695e13a091e:0
- value
- 679600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 473612f42050296f3ce04ec05bcc332645103acd OP_EQUAL
- address
- 38BYgHzJBXU6XbEYTcMW3a6VnCAtVpArS4